About Agoda

At Agoda, we bridge the world through travel. Our story began in 2005, when two lifelong friends and entrepreneurs, driven by their passion for travel, launched Agoda to make it easier for everyone to explore the world.  

 

Today, we are part of Booking Holdings [NASDAQ: BKNG], with a diverse team of over 7,000 people from 90 countries, working together in offices around the globe. Every day, we connect people to destinations and experiences, with our great deals across our millions of hotels and holiday properties, flights, and experiences worldwide.

 

No two days are the same at Agoda. Data and technology are at the heart of our culture, fueling our curiosity and innovation. If you’re ready to begin your best journey and help build travel for the world, join us.

About the Role

We are seeking a detail-oriented and communicative Junior Hotel Tax Compliance Coordinator for a 2-month fixed-term contract. This role will focus on contacting hotels to collect and verify their tax registration codes, ensuring our database remains accurate and compliant with regulatory requirements.

This role is to be based out of Vietnam only. No visa/ relocation provided.

Key Responsibilities

  • Contact hotels via phone and email to request tax registration codes
  • Maintain accurate records of all communications and data collected
  • Follow up with hotels to ensure timely responses
  • Update internal systems with verified tax information
  • Escalate any issues or discrepancies to the supervisor
  • Prepare regular progress reports on outreach activities

Requirements

  • College degree (any discipline)
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Comfortable speaking with hotel representatives and building professional relationships
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el, Outlook)
  • Self-motivated with ability to work independently
  • Previous customer service or administrative experience is a plus

What We Offer

  • Competitive contract compensation
  • Exposure to hospitality industry operations
  • Supportive team environment
  • Flexible working arrangements
